Where this album fits
- Career context
- By 1998, Sonic Youth was transitioning from their late '80s and early '90s critical acclaim into a more experimental phase. 'A Thousand Leaves' marked their first release after their major label tenure, showcasing a distinct shift towards abstract soundscapes while still retaining their punk roots.
